βœ… Recommended Size & Resolution

YouTube has specific requirements for thumbnail images that ensure optimal display across all platforms and devices. Here are the official specifications for 2025:

🎯 Official YouTube Thumbnail Specifications

πŸ“ Dimensions

  • β€’ Recommended: 1280 Γ— 720 pixels
  • β€’ Minimum Width: 640 pixels
  • β€’ Aspect Ratio: 16:9 (1.78:1)
  • β€’ Maximum File Size: 2MB

πŸ“ File Format

  • β€’ Supported: JPG, PNG, GIF, BMP
  • β€’ Recommended: JPG or PNG
  • β€’ Color Space: sRGB
  • β€’ Bit Depth: 8-bit or higher

Understanding the 16:9 Aspect Ratio

The 16:9 aspect ratio is crucial because it matches YouTube's video player and interface design. This ensures your thumbnail displays properly without cropping or distortion across all devices.

πŸ“ Aspect Ratio Calculator

Formula: Width Γ· Height = 1.78 (16:9 ratio)
Example: 1280 Γ· 720 = 1.78 βœ“

4K and High-DPI Displays

πŸ–₯️ Display Technology Impact

With 4K monitors becoming standard and mobile devices featuring high-DPI screens, low-resolution thumbnails appear blurry and unprofessional. The 1280Γ—720 specification ensures crisp display across all modern devices.

Responsive Design Requirements

YouTube's interface adapts to different screen sizes, and your thumbnails need to look good at various scales:

πŸ“± Mobile

Thumbnails appear smaller on mobile devices, requiring clear, readable text and high contrast.

πŸ’» Desktop

Larger displays show more detail, making high-resolution thumbnails essential for professional appearance.

πŸ“Ί Smart TV

TV interfaces display thumbnails at larger sizes, where resolution quality becomes immediately apparent.

Safe Zone Considerations

YouTube may crop or overlay elements on your thumbnail, so design with safe zones in mind:

⚠️ Safe Zone Guidelines

Keep important text and subjects away from the edges (within 10% of the frame) to avoid being cropped or covered by YouTube's interface elements like play buttons, duration overlays, or channel badges.

⚠️ Common Mistakes to Avoid

Many creators make these technical errors that hurt their thumbnail performance. Avoid these common pitfalls:

❌ Wrong Aspect Ratio

  • β€’ Using square (1:1) images
  • β€’ Vertical (9:16) thumbnails
  • β€’ Custom ratios that don't fit 16:9
  • β€’ Results in cropping or letterboxing

❌ Low Resolution

  • β€’ Using images below 640px width
  • β€’ Upscaling small images
  • β€’ Blurry or pixelated thumbnails
  • β€’ Poor appearance on 4K displays

🎯 Pre-Publishing Checklist

  • βœ… Verify dimensions are 1280Γ—720 pixels
  • βœ… Check file size is under 2MB
  • βœ… Confirm aspect ratio is 16:9
  • βœ… Test readability on mobile devices
  • βœ… Ensure text is legible at small sizes
